How to Find a Civil Lawyer You Can Trust



Locating a reliable law professional specializing in civil cases can feel overwhelming. Begin by seeking recommendations from family or your local lawyer's organization . Online platforms like your state's bar website or sites like Avvo and Martindale-Hubbell offer detailed profiles and customer ratings. Always set up initial consultations with several lawyers to evaluate their experience, interaction style, and overall approach to your specific situation . Don't be afraid to inquire about their costs, record, and past successes . Trust your instinct – choose someone who makes you feel at ease and who you trust will competently represent your concerns.


Civil Law Explained: When Do You Need a Attorney ?



Civil law concerns conflicts between parties – it's separate from criminal law, which focuses on offenses against the state. Typically, civil cases involve allegations for damages , such as failure of promise, bodily harm , real estate destruction , or slander . Knowing whether you require legal counsel can be complicated . Evaluate seeking a attorney's guidance should you've been named in a civil action , are involved in a significant financial dispute , or believe your protections have been breached.




  • You’ve been sued .

  • A substantial sum of money is at stake .

  • The matter is complex .

  • You are unsure of the legal system.


Choosing a Litigation Lawyer: Key Inquiries to Ask



Finding the right civil lawyer can seem a daunting task. To help you make an sensible selection, it’s essential to inquire about several important questions. Below is a compilation of what to address get more info during your initial consultation.

  • What is your experience in handling cases like this type of claim?
  • How many analogous cases have you worked on and what were the resolutions?
  • What is your rate arrangement and what expenses are included ?
  • Who will be primarily in charge for my case and will I receive direct communication to them?
  • How will you keep me informed about the development of my case matter?
Remember to also assess their communication style and verify you have at ease with their approach .
